Daifuku Co. Ltd
Daifuku Co., Ltd. offers consulting, engineering, design, manufacture, installation, and after-sales services for logistics systems and material handling equipment in Japan and internationally. Based on the latest financial reports, Daifuku Co. Ltd (DFKCY) holds total assets worth $754.73 Billion USD as of December 2025.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.
